Abstract
A hypothetical energy quantization condition is imposed in [1] (Francisco A. Cruz Neto {\it et al.}, arXiv : 1910.11701 [gr-qc]) in order to show consistent of the result with those in [2] but fail or unable to show consistency with those in [3].
